Washington DC [US], January 29 (ANI): Rapper Nicki Minaj has declared herself the 'No 1 fan' of US President Donald Trump.
Speaking at the 'Trump Accounts Summit' in Washington DC on Wednesday, Nicki Minaj doubled down on her persistent support for Trump, stating that the US President has been 'bullied and smeared'.
'I don't know what to say, but I will say that I am probably the president's No. 1 fan. And that's not going to change. And the hate, or what people have to say, it does not affect me at all. It actually motivates me to support him more. And it's gonna motivate all of us to support him more,' Minaj said at the summit, as quoted by The Hollywood Reporter.

Showcasing her strong rapport with Trump, she added, 'We're not going to let them get away with bullying him, and the smear campaigns, it's not going to work, OK? He has a lot of force behind him, and God is protecting him.'
The US President also heaped praise on Nicki Minaj and said, 'She is the greatest and the most successful female rapper in history,' he added.
This came roughly a month after the rapper made a surprise appearance at Turning Point USA's AmericaFest conference in December last year. In an interview, she led extensive praise for the Trump administration.
'I have the utmost respect and admiration for our president. I don't know if he even knows this, but he's given so many people hope,' she said.
In another instance, she commended Trump over threats to take military action against Nigeria over the country's alleged persecution of Christians. (ANI)
